The announcement comes as autoimmune diseases affect roughly 10% of the population, according to a large-scale study published in The Lancet. A separate Lancet study found that people with autoimmune conditions face a 1.4 to 3.6 times higher risk of cardiovascular disease than those without such a diagnosis.
